Why Quality Makes All the Difference
The
effectiveness of black seed oil largely depends on its purity and method of
extraction. High-quality versions are usually cold-pressed and stored in dark
glass bottles to preserve their nutrient profile. These oils contain a higher
concentration of thymoquinone—a key antioxidant and anti-inflammatory
compound—responsible for many of black seed oil’s benefits.
In
contrast, low-grade oils may be blended with cheaper oils or subjected to
heat-based extraction processes. These methods reduce nutritional value and
effectiveness, making them less reliable for those seeking real results.

How to Use Black Seed Oil Daily
Black
seed oil can be taken orally or used topically, depending on your goals. For
general wellness, most people start with a small dose—usually half a teaspoon
per day—and gradually increase it. When using topically, a few drops can be
applied directly to the skin or mixed with carrier oils for massage or hair
care.
It’s
best to consult a healthcare provider before adding it to your routine,
especially if you're pregnant, breastfeeding, or taking medications.
